IEEE P1516.1/D5h, Oct 2009 is an IEEE draft standard focused on the Modeling and Simulation (M&S) High Level Architecture (HLA) federate interface specification. In practical terms, it addresses how a federate connects and exchanges information within an HLA-based simulation environment, which is important for consistent interoperability in computing and processing applications. IEEE P1516.1/D5h, Oct 2009 helps define a common technical framework for systems that must coordinate simulation behavior and data exchange reliably.

Overview of IEEE P1516.1/D5h, Oct 2009

This draft standard sits within the HLA framework for distributed modeling and simulation, where multiple federates participate in a shared run-time environment. Its purpose is to describe the interface behavior expected between a federate and the HLA infrastructure, supporting predictable communication, object and interaction handling, and coordinated execution. For teams working with simulation software or integration tooling, IEEE P1516.1/D5h, Oct 2009 provides a reference point for interface consistency and technical alignment.

Typical use cases

IEEE P1516.1/D5h, Oct 2009 is typically relevant when developing or integrating simulation components that must operate as federates in an HLA federation. That may include training simulators, analysis tools, distributed test environments, or mission and system models that need controlled data exchange. It is especially useful for software engineers and simulation architects defining how interfaces should behave across multiple computing nodes, model participants, or connected simulation services.
